Detroit rewards curious walkers with a narrative of resilience and reinvention. The downtown core has been revitalized around Campus Martius Park, with historic skyscrapers, restaurants, and the sparkling Detroit Riverwalk along the waterfront. The Detroit Institute of Arts houses Diego Rivera's famous Industry Murals and a world-class collection in a stunning Beaux-Arts building. Midtown clusters cultural institutions, craft breweries, and the Motown Museum in the tiny house where Berry Gordy launched the careers of Stevie Wonder, Diana Ross, and Marvin Gaye. Corktown, Detroit's oldest neighborhood, has become the epicenter of the dining scene, anchored by the beautifully restored Michigan Central Station. Eastern Market is one of the largest public markets in the country, with Saturday markets, street art, and the smell of roasting coffee filling the warehouse district.

Top Shopping Tour Spots

  • Eastern Market — a 43-acre, 130-year-old market district with 250+ vendors on Saturdays, surrounded by murals and shed buildings selling everything from flowers to corned beef
  • Michigan Central Station — a monumental 1913 Beaux-Arts train station recently restored by Ford as a technology hub, once the tallest rail station in the world at 18 stories

Hidden Shopping Tour Gems

  • Guardian Building — a 1929 Art Deco skyscraper with one of the most spectacular lobbies in America, featuring Pewabic tile and Aztec-inspired design

Walking Tip

Detroit's attractions are spread across distinct districts — drive or take the QLine streetcar between Midtown, Downtown, and Corktown, then explore each neighborhood on foot.

Best Time to Visit

May through October offers warm weather and the city's best events, including outdoor concerts, festivals, and the bustling Eastern Market at its peak.
